A person invites a party of 10 friends at dinner and place them so that 4 are on one round table and 6 on the other round table. The number of ways in which he can arrange the guests is

A

`((10)!)/(6!)`

B

`((10)!)/(24)`

C

`((9)!)/(24)`

D

None of these

Text Solution

Verified by Experts

The correct Answer is:
B
